Adult Male Sea Otter Admitted From Tofino

On Friday, May 29, an adult male sea otter was admitted to the Vancouver Aquarium Marine Mammal Rescue Society (VAMMR) after being found in distress at Chesterman Beach near Tofino. Young Harbour Seal Rescued

Young Harbour Seal Rescued After Gillnet Entanglement in West Vancouver The Vancouver Aquarium Marine Mammal Rescue Society (VAMMR) has rescued a young harbour seal from a life-threatening gillnet entanglement in West Vancouver.
